As for the ey sight thing, I dont know my specific figures, I havent had an eye test in aaaages, I am going to get them done and some new glasses before I take my medical exam though as I am sure my prescription has changed considerably since i got my current set of specs! There IS a limit to how bad your eye sight can be, I think I read somehwre it can be no worse than +/-5 diopters (units and spelling!?) and I gather that is quite sever. But I am no optitian so I dont really know enough about it to give you any definate figures. I read that from the description of the medical exam, I do not have all the paperwork with this stuff on with me at the moment, but if i remember correctly, its a JAA Class 1 medical exam that one has to take and pass (and self-fund, 400 pounds and take at gatwick Airport) before you can even start training in an aircraft.

I would assume there are less intense certificates you can get, with this being named for class 1, that may just be for private flying, but with this course aiming to churn out fuly qualified airline pilots, I guess they want you to get the full monty straight away!
